What Is Telemedicine?
The idea of telemedicine has been introduced previously. Its inception may be traced back to the 1960s when NASA's space program was one of the first to use communication and remote monitoring technologies to treat astronauts. Telemedicine has become an essential part of contemporary healthcare systems because of the tremendous expansion of its scope and reach brought about by the development of information and communication technologies (ICT).
How to Enhance Access to Healthcare?
Enhancing access to healthcare services is one of telemedicine's most important benefits, especially for underserved and remote communities. Telemedicine fills the gap between patients and healthcare practitioners in rural and distant places with little healthcare infrastructure. Electronic health records (EHRs), video consultations, and remote monitoring allow patients to receive prompt and accurate medical advice without traveling and incur additional fees.
Telemedicine is also very important in alleviating healthcare inequities. The elderly and people with impairments who live in metropolitan areas and have restricted mobility find telemedicine a convenient way to receive healthcare services right at their door. Additionally, telemedicine platforms can provide multilingual services, guaranteeing that access to healthcare is not hampered by language difficulties.
How to Improve Efficiency in Healthcare Delivery?
Telemedicine improves the effectiveness of healthcare delivery by reducing procedures and making the best use of available resources. By relieving the strain on medical institutions, virtual consultations free up resources and physical space for patients who need in-person care. This lowers waiting times and increases patient satisfaction, improving patient flow overall.
Remote monitoring and telehealth technologies enable continuous monitoring of patients with chronic illnesses, prompt interventions, and early detection of potential consequences. This proactive approach to healthcare eventually lowers healthcare expenses by reducing hospital admissions and readmissions. Furthermore, telemedicine makes it easier for medical professionals to work together, empowering multidisciplinary teams to coordinate care and reach well-informed judgments efficiently.

How to Address Public Health Emergencies?
Telemedicine has proven invaluable in managing public health situations like pandemics and natural disasters. The COVID-19 pandemic highlighted how crucial telemedicine is for maintaining patient continuity of treatment while lowering infection risks. Telemedicine technologies allow healthcare professionals to screen patients, provide virtual consultations, and offer remote monitoring and follow-up care.
Telemedicine is helpful in situations involving infectious disease outbreaks and disaster response. It can help affected populations receive medical care during natural disasters when physical infrastructure may be compromised. Telemedicine-capable mobile health units can deliver care on-site and arrange appointments with specialists.
How to Overcome Challenges?
While telemedicine offers many advantages, some issues must be resolved if its full potential is to be reached. The digital divide is one of the main issues. Reliable internet connectivity and digital literacy are prerequisites for accessing telemedicine, but these skills may only be present in some communities, especially in low-income and rural areas. To guarantee that all people have fair access to telemedicine services, efforts must be made to upgrade digital infrastructure and offer training in digital literacy.
Concerns about security and privacy pose serious obstacles to telemedicine as well. Digital systems that transmit sensitive health information raise concerns about data breaches and illegal access. Encryption, secure authentication, and adherence to data protection laws are strong security methods essential to protecting patient data.
Further difficulties come from reimbursement and regulatory concerns. The transmission of telemedicine services across borders might be complicated by the various laws and licensing requirements that apply to different jurisdictions. Furthermore, there are differences in coverage and payment methods, and reimbursement policies for telemedicine services are still being developed. An atmosphere that is conducive to telemedicine requires standardized laws and payment procedures.
What Are the Future Prospects?
With ongoing technological developments and the growing acceptance of patients and healthcare providers, the future of telemedicine is bright. New technologies that have the potential to improve telemedicine skills include blockchain, machine learning, and artificial intelligence (AI). AI-powered diagnostic tools, predictive analytics, and virtual health assistants can enhance the decision-making process, increasing the precision and effectiveness of telemedicine services.
Additionally, telemedicine is anticipated to be crucial to advancing precision medicine. Using big data and genomics, telemedicine can provide individualized treatment programs customized to each patient's genetic profile, lifestyle, and medical condition. By decreasing adverse responses, increasing patient outcomes, and offering focused and effective therapies, this strategy has the potential to transform the healthcare industry completely.
Furthermore, continuous real-time monitoring of patient's health metrics will be made possible by combining telemedicine with wearable technology and the Internet of Things (IoT). Vital sign data, physical activity data, and other health measurements can be gathered by wearable devices and sent to healthcare providers for review and possible action. This ongoing monitoring and data-driven strategy will make proactive and preventive healthcare possible, lessening the burden of chronic diseases.
